Stacey Abrams: ‘I Do Not See a Third Party Candidate Making Inroads in Georgia’
‘I think that the satisfaction with President Biden is strong and high’
EXCERPT:
ABRAMS: "While I believe that if you can stand for office and you are qualified, it is your right to do so, I think the structural nature of elections in the United States for the presidency tend to diminish the utility of a third party. I think that the satisfaction with President Biden is strong and high. I do not see a third-party candidate making inroads in Georgia or many other places."
